This principle of art … WebOct 22, 2012 · A good example are the stripes on a tiger or zebra. No stripe is quite like the next. Seen together they create a rhythm of natural movement. Gradually decreasing the observed size of the posts and the space between them creates a progressive rhythm. Progressive rhythm — occurs when a sequence of forms or shapes is shown through a …

WebMay 27, 2024 · Movement in art is the path, flow, or suggestion of movement which causes the eyes to follow in an intended direction. It utilizes shapes, color, line, and arrangement in space to create the illusion, implication ( juxtaposition) of, or visual queue alluding to motion. WebRepetition is a repeating visual element (line, shape, pattern, texture, movement), and rhythm is its flowing and regular occurrence. A subcategory of repetition is pattern. Pattern – any compositionally repeated element or regular repetition of a design or single shape; pattern drawing sin commercial art may serve as models for commercial imitation.
